Swift Creek Mill Theatre presents DRIFTY'S HOLIDAY FOLLIES
![]()
Legendary Hollywood film director Max Von Strudel has been hired to transform the annual North Pole Follies into something even more spectacular! Trouble is, there's not much in the talent pool, until Mr. Von Strudel discovers his newest star, Drifty the Snowman, whose poem "The Noble Fir" becomes the highlight of the big finale!
